wonszov Posted December 17, 2020 Share Posted December 17, 2020 (edited) After starting fresh instal today I had the same problem, 1.5mb max. What helped in my case was enabling windows autotuning back, some windows update supposedly turned it off. Here is more about it https://www.thewindowsclub.com/window-auto-tuning-in-windows-10 Now it goes +-25 MB/s Edited December 17, 2020 by wonszov 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Flappie Posted December 18, 2020 Share Posted December 18, 2020 (edited) Same here, this is super fast on my rig. We need to find what you guys with slow DCS downloading speed have in common. Are you using a VPN? Have you ensured Receive Window auto-tuning is turned ON? If yes, try turning it off and see if it's any better ( netsh int tcp set global autotuninglevel=disabled )*. What is your antivirus? What is your active firewall? Is your PC behind a proxy? *You can re-enable Receive Window auto-tuning with this command: netsh int tcp set global autotuninglevel=normal Edited December 18, 2020 by Flappie Don't accept indie game testing requests from friends in Discord.
